How much ObamaCare costs the average family (Dick Morris and Eileen McGann, 10/16/09, The Hill)
If your household income is $66,000 a year, slightly above the national average, Obama’s healthcare bill will require you to spend 12 percent of your income — about $8,000 a year or almost $700 a month — to buy health insurance before you get any federal subsidy. * Even those making less will have to reach deep into their meager resources to satisfy Obama’s statutory requirement. Families scraping by on only $44,0000 a year will have to pay 7 percent of their income (about $3,000) on insurance.* Even those making just $33,000 will have to ante up 4.5 percent of their income (about $1500) for health insurance.
